Obituary
Drowned in a Well
Mikel Mikelson, of 12 Mile Lake township, about three miles northwest of Wallingford, fell into a well yesterday and was drowned. He was an old man and was reaching into the well to get some water with which to "prime", when he lost his hold and fell head foremost into the water. He was too feeble to get out. (Emmet County Reporter, Emmet County Republican, Estherville, IA., May 23, 1895)
Note: Tombstone says he died 22 June 1895 and newspaper notice of death was in the 23 of May 1895 newspaper.
